Bikie murder witnesses 'fear for their lives'

By ACT court reporter Katherine Pohl

Updated Thu Sep 9, 2010 2:26pm AEST

Richard Roberts was shot dead in March last year. He was a life-long member of the Rebels Motorcycle Club.

A Canberra court has been told some witnesses involved in the trial of a man accused of murdering a Rebels Motorcycle Club member fear for their lives.

Russell Field, 20, is expected to go on trial in just over a week for the shooting murder of Richard John Roberts, 57, and Gregory Peter Carrigan, 48, at a Chisholm home in March 2009.

Mr Roberts was a life-long member of the Rebels Motorcycle Club.

Police have previously told the ACT Supreme Court, the club might seek retribution for the death.

It is understood that the prosecution and defence counsel have been consulting with the police over what security measures might need to be in place for the trial.

Field's barrister told the court, some witnesses do not want to be named because they fear for their lives.
